Classic Mojito
The Classic Mojito is a refreshing Cuban cocktail that perfectly balances the brightness of lime, the coolness of mint, and the smoothness of white rum. Follow these steps to create the perfect mojito:
Ingredients:
- 2 oz white rum
- 1 oz fresh lime juice (about 1/2 lime)
- 2 teaspoons white sugar
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- Club soda water
- Ice cubes
- Lime wheel and mint sprig for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the glass: Use a highball glass or Collins glass. Add the sugar to the bottom of the glass.
- Muddle the mint: Add the fresh mint leaves to the glass. Using a muddler or the back of a spoon, gently press and twist the mint leaves to release their oils. Be careful not to over-muddle as this can make the drink bitter.
- Add lime juice: Pour the fresh lime juice over the muddled mint and sugar. Stir gently to dissolve the sugar.
- Add rum: Pour the white rum into the glass and stir well to combine all ingredients.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top.
- Top with soda: Slowly pour club soda water to fill the glass, leaving about 1/2 inch from the rim.
- Final stir: Give the drink a gentle stir to mix all ingredients.
- Garnish: Garnish with a lime wheel and a fresh mint sprig. Lightly slap the mint sprig between your hands before adding to release additional aroma.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y!
Pro Tips:
- Use fresh mint leaves for the best flavor
- Don’t over-muddle the mint to avoid bitterness
- Adjust sugar to taste preference
- Use good quality white rum for the best results
- Serve in a chilled glass for extra refreshment
Strawberry Mojito
This refreshing Strawberry Mojito is a delightful fruity twist on the classic Cuban cocktail. Perfect for summer parties and warm evenings, this vibrant pink drink combines the sweetness of fresh strawberries with the coolness of mint and the tanginess of lime.
Ingredients:
- 6-8 fresh strawberries, hulled and quartered
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 1 lime, cut into wedges
- 2 tablespoons white sugar (or simple syrup)
- 2 oz white rum
- 1/2 cup club soda or sparkling water
- Ice cubes
- Fresh strawberry slices and mint sprigs for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the glass: Use a highball glass or large tumbler. If desired, rim the glass with sugar for extra sweetness.
- Muddle the strawberries: Place the quartered strawberries in the bottom of the glass and gently muddle them to release their juices and create a chunky puree.
- Add mint and lime: Add the fresh mint leaves and lime wedges to the glass. Muddle gently to release the mint oils and lime juice, being careful not to over-muddle the mint as it can become bitter.
- Add sugar: Sprinkle the sugar over the muddled mixture and stir to combine. The sugar will help extract more flavors from the fruit.
- Add rum: Pour the white rum over the muddled mixture and stir well to combine all ingredients.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top for the soda.
- Top with soda: Pour the club soda or sparkling water over the ice, filling the glass almost to the top.
- Stir and garnish: Give the drink a gentle stir to mix all ingredients. Garnish with fresh strawberry slices and a sprig of mint.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y your refreshing Strawberry Mojito!
Tips:
- For a sweeter drink, add more sugar or use simple syrup instead of granulated sugar
- Choose ripe, sweet strawberries for the best flavor
- Don’t over-muddle the mint to avoid bitterness
- For a non-alcoholic version, simply omit the rum and add more club soda
- Chill your glass beforehand for an extra refreshing experience
Virgin Mojito
Ingredients:
- 10-12 fresh mint leaves
- 1 lime, cut into wedges
- 2 tablespoons white sugar (or 1 tablespoon simple syrup)
- 1 cup soda water (club soda)
- Ice cubes
- Extra mint sprigs for garnish
- Lime wheel for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the glass: Use a highball glass or tall glass. Add the mint leaves to the bottom of the glass.
- Muddle the mint: Using a muddler or the back of a spoon, gently press the mint leaves to release their oils. Be careful not to over-muddle as it can make the drink bitter.
- Add lime and sugar: Add the lime wedges and sugar to the glass. Muddle again to extract the lime juice and dissolve the sugar.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top.
- Add soda water: Pour the soda water over the ice, filling the glass almost to the top.
- Stir gently: Use a long spoon to gently stir the mixture, combining all ingredients.
- Garnish: Top with a sprig of fresh mint and a lime wheel on the rim.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this refreshing alcohol-free cocktail!
Tips: For best results, chill the glass beforehand and use freshly squeezed lime juice. You can also add a splash of lime juice if you prefer a more tart flavor.
Mango Mojito
This tropical Mango Mojito combines the refreshing elements of a classic mojito with the sweet, creamy flavor of ripe mango. Perfect for summer entertaining or a relaxing evening drink.
Ingredients:
- 1 ripe mango, peeled and diced
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
- 1 tablespoon sugar (or simple syrup)
- 2 oz white rum
- 1/2 cup club soda or sparkling water
- Ice cubes
- Lime wedges and mint sprigs for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the mango: Peel and dice the ripe mango into small chunks. Set aside a few pieces for garnish.
- Muddle the base: In a tall glass, add the diced mango, mint leaves, lime juice, and sugar. Gently muddle together until the mango is well mashed and the mint releases its aroma.
- Add rum: Pour the white rum over the muddled mixture and stir well to combine all flavors.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top.
- Top with soda: Slowly pour the club soda or sparkling water over the ice to fill the glass.
- Stir and garnish: Give the drink a gentle stir to mix all ingredients. Garnish with lime wedges, reserved mango pieces, and a fresh mint sprig.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this tropical twist on the classic mojito.
Tips: Use very ripe mango for the best flavor, and adjust the sweetness according to your preference. You can also blend the mango for a smoother texture if desired.
Watermelon Mojito
Ingredients:
- 2 cups fresh watermelon, cubed and seeds removed
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 2 oz white rum
- 1 oz fresh lime juice
- 1 tablespoon simple syrup (or to taste)
- Club soda or sparkling water
- Ice cubes
- Lime wedges for garnish
- Fresh mint sprigs for garnish
- Watermelon wedges for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the watermelon: Cut the watermelon into cubes and remove all seeds. You can either juice the watermelon using a blender and strain it, or muddle the pieces directly in the glass.
- Muddle the mint: In a highball glass or mojito glass, gently muddle the mint leaves to release their oils. Be careful not to over-muddle as this can make the drink bitter.
- Add watermelon: If using cubed watermelon, add it to the glass and muddle gently with the mint. If using watermelon juice, add 3-4 oz of fresh watermelon juice to the glass.
- Add lime and sweetener: Pour in the fresh lime juice and simple syrup. Stir gently to combine all ingredients.
- Add rum: Pour the white rum over the muddled mixture and stir briefly.
- Fill with 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top for the soda.
- Top with soda: Top off the drink with club soda or sparkling water, stirring gently to combine.
- Garnish and serve: Garnish with a lime wedge, fresh mint sprig, and a small watermelon wedge on the rim. Serve immediately with a straw.
Tips:
- For best results, use very ripe and sweet watermelon
- Adjust sweetness by adding more or less simple syrup
- For a non-alcoholic version, simply omit the rum
- Can be made in a pitcher for parties – multiply ingredients accordingly
Passion Fruit Mojito
Ingredients:
- 2 oz white rum
- 1 oz fresh lime juice
- 2 tablespoons passion fruit pulp (or 1 oz passion fruit juice)
- 2 teaspoons sugar or simple syrup
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- Club soda or sparkling water
- Ice cubes
- Lime wheel and mint sprig for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the glass: Use a highball or Collins glass. Fill it with ice cubes and set aside.
- Muddle the mint: In the bottom of the glass, gently muddle the mint leaves with sugar or simple syrup. Be careful not to over-muddle as it can make the drink bitter.
- Add passion fruit: Add the passion fruit pulp or juice to the glass. The seeds from fresh passion fruit add texture and visual appeal.
- Mix the base: Pour in the white rum and fresh lime juice. Stir gently to combine all ingredients.
- Add ice and top: Fill the glass with more ice if needed, then top with club soda or sparkling water, leaving about an inch from the rim.
- Final stir: Give the drink a gentle stir to incorporate all flavors without losing the carbonation.
- Garnish and serve: Garnish with a lime wheel and a fresh mint sprig. Serve immediately with a straw.
Tips:
- For best results, use fresh passion fruit pulp with seeds for authentic flavor and texture
- Adjust sweetness according to the tartness of your passion fruit
- Chill all ingredients beforehand for a refreshing drink
- Serve in a chilled glass for optimal experience
Coconut Mojito
This tropical twist on the classic mojito combines the refreshing taste of mint with the rich, creamy flavor of coconut for a truly paradise-inspired cocktail.
Ingredients:
- 2 oz coconut rum
- 1 oz coconut cream
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 1 oz fresh lime juice
- 1 tablespoon simple syrup
- Club soda
- Ice cubes
- Lime wedges for garnish
- Fresh mint sprig for garnish
- Toasted coconut flakes (optional)
Instructions:
- Muddle the mint: In a tall glass, gently muddle the mint leaves with simple syrup and lime juice. Be careful not to over-muddle as this can make the drink bitter.
- Add coconut ingredients: Pour in the coconut rum and coconut cream. Stir gently to combine all ingredients.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ving room at the top for soda.
- Top with soda: Slowly pour club soda to fill the glass, leaving about an inch from the rim.
- Stir and garnish: Give the drink a gentle stir to mix all ingredients. Garnish with a lime wedge, fresh mint sprig, and a sprinkle of toasted coconut flakes if desired.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this tropical escape in a glass.
Pro tip: For an extra creamy texture, you can substitute coconut cream with cream of coconut (like Coco López) for a sweeter, richer flavor.
Pineapple Mojito
This refreshing Pineapple Mojito combines the tropical sweetness of fresh pineapple with the classic mint and lime flavors of a traditional mojito. Perfect for summer gatherings or beach-themed parties.
Ingredients:
- 2 oz white rum
- 1/2 cup fresh pineapple chunks or 1/4 cup fresh pineapple juice
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 1/2 lime, cut into wedges
- 2 tsp sugar or simple syrup
- Club soda or sparkling water
- Ice cubes
- Pineapple wedge and mint sprig for garnish
Instructions:
- Muddle the ingredients: In a tall glass, add the fresh pineapple chunks, mint leaves, lime wedges, and sugar. Gently muddle everything together using a muddler or the back of a spoon to release the juices and oils.
- Add rum: Pour the white rum over the muddled mixture and stir gently to combine all flavors.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top for the soda.
- Top with soda: Pour club soda or sparkling water to fill the glass, leaving about an inch from the rim.
- Stir and garnish: Give the drink a gentle stir to mix all ingredients. Garnish with a fresh pineapple wedge and a sprig of mint.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this tropical twist on the classic mojito!
Tips: For best results, use fresh pineapple juice or chunks rather than canned. The natural sweetness and acidity of fresh pineapple will create a more vibrant and authentic tropical flavor.
Blackberry Mojito
This sophisticated berry variation elevates the classic mojito with fresh blackberries, creating a beautiful deep purple cocktail perfect for special occasions.
Ingredients:
- 8-10 fresh blackberries
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 1 lime, cut into quarters
- 2 tablespoons sugar (or simple syrup)
- 2 oz white rum
- Club soda
- Ice cubes
- Extra blackberries and mint for garnish
Instructions:
- Muddle the berries: Place fresh blackberries in the bottom of a highball glass. Gently muddle them to release their juices and create a deep purple base.
- Add mint and lime: Add fresh mint leaves and lime quarters to the glass. Muddle gently to release the mint oils and lime juice, being careful not to over-muddle the mint.
- Sweeten: Add sugar or simple syrup and muddle briefly to dissolve.
- Add rum: Pour in the white rum and stir to combine with the muddled fruit mixture.
- Fill with ice: Add ice cubes to fill the glass about 3/4 full.
- Top with soda: Fill the remaining space with club soda, leaving room for garnish.
- Stir and garnish: Gently stir to combine all ingredients. Garnish with fresh blackberries and a sprig of mint.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this elegant berry cocktail.
Tips: For the best flavor, use ripe blackberries and fresh mint. The drink should have a beautiful deep purple color from the muddled blackberries and a perfect balance of sweet and tart flavors.
Pomegranate Mojito
Ingredients:
- 2 oz white rum
- 1 oz fresh lime juice
- 2 oz pomegranate juice
- 2 tablespoons fresh pomegranate seeds
- 8-10 fresh mint leaves
- 2 teaspoons sugar or simple syrup
- Club soda
- Ice cubes
- Lime wedges for garnish
- Additional mint sprigs for garnish
Instructions:
- Prepare the glass: Use a tall highball or Collins glass. Add the fresh mint leaves and sugar to the bottom of the glass.
- Muddle the mint: Gently muddle the mint leaves with the sugar using a muddler or the back of a spoon. Be careful not to over-muddle as this can make the drink bitter.
- Add pomegranate elements: Add the pomegranate seeds to the glass and lightly muddle them to release their juice and flavor.
- Add lime and rum: Pour in the fresh lime juice and white rum. Stir gently to combine all ingredients.
- Add pomegranate juice: Pour in the pomegranate juice, which will create a beautiful ruby red color throughout the drink.
- Add ice: Fill the glass with ice cubes, leaving some room at the top.
- Top with soda: Top off the drink with club soda, leaving about an inch of space at the top of the glass.
- Final stir: Give the drink a gentle stir to distribute all flavors evenly.
- Garnish: Garnish with lime wedges, fresh mint sprigs, and a few extra pomegranate seeds on top for visual appeal.
- Serve: Serve immediately with a straw and enjoy this antioxidant-rich, refreshing cocktail.
Tips:
- For best results, use fresh pomegranate juice rather than bottled for optimal flavor and color
- Adjust sweetness according to taste – pomegranate can be quite tart
- Chill the glass beforehand for an extra refreshing experience
- The drink can be made virgin by omitting the rum and adding more pomegranate juice
